Output 2ba6eb52b92c73e2ec647e89fd9d5a7677a5a601e55f63e3f73d2a985ac74ebc:2

value
21505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afbd3ee7759c0759fba2a4c74dacb0cbde5b7765 OP_EQUAL
address
3HiEt8uhSg8sJLexADdthtAeeD7j1KDmhL
transaction
2ba6eb52b92c73e2ec647e89fd9d5a7677a5a601e55f63e3f73d2a985ac74ebc
spent
true